WASHINGTON, Jan 17 (Reuters) - TikTok warned late Friday it will go dark in the United States on Sunday unless President Joe Biden's administration provides assurances to companies like Apple and Google that they will not face enforcement actions when a ban takes effect.
The statement came hours after the Supreme Court upheld a law banning TikTok in the United States on national security grounds if its Chinese parent company ByteDance does not sell it, putting the popular short-video app on track to go dark in just two days.

“TikTok automatically captures vast swaths of information from its users, including internet and other network activity information such as location data and browsing and search histories. This data collection threatens to allow the Chinese Communist Party access to Americans' personal and proprietary information—potentially allowing China to track the locations of Federal employees and contractors, build dossiers of personal information for blackmail, and conduct corporate espionage.” -federal register.gov

There are many reasons why it is bad for foreign governments to collect our data. We, the USA, had a secret base that was discovered because people were logging their exercise data online. It showed their running routes and what got outlined was the perimeter of a secret base. Look it up. The app was called Strava and the base was in Afghanistan.
When people have no idea how things work, and are unaware of security risks, it puts everyone at risk.

On the national security questions that are being raised, it's not that TixTox gathers your data with your permission that's at issue. As stated all apps collect data. What makes it a national security issue is that TixTok's parent company ByteDance is a Chinese owned company and is required by Chinese law to turn over all data gathered to the government upon request. That requirement is what makes it a national security for the US.
